隨著互聯網的發展,Web前端技術也迅速得到發展,CSS動畫在現代網頁設計中被廣泛應用。今天我們來討論一下CSS動畫的點擊效果。
首先,我們需要明確CSS動畫可以作用在哪些元素上。CSS動畫可以作用在文字、圖片、背景等元素上,在這些元素上實現點擊效果也很簡單。
下面是一個例子,實現了點擊圖片時圖片會放大的效果:
<html>
<head>
<title>CSS動畫點擊效果</title>
<style>
img:hover {
transform: scale(1.1);
}
</style>
</head>
<body>
<img src="img.jpg">
</body>
</html>
在上面的代碼中,我們給圖片添加:hover偽類,當鼠標懸停在圖片上時,transform屬性會對圖片進行放大操作。
同樣的,在文字上實現點擊效果也很簡單。下面是一個例子,實現了點擊文字時文字顏色會變化的效果:
<html>
<head>
<title>CSS動畫點擊效果</title>
<style>
p:hover {
color: red;
cursor: pointer;
}
</style>
</head>
<body>
<p>點擊這里</p>
</body>
</html>
在上面的代碼中,我們給文字添加:hover偽類,當鼠標懸停在文字上時,color屬性會改變文字顏色為紅色,同時添加了cursor:pointer屬性來提示用戶該文字可以被單擊。
總之,CSS動畫點擊效果可以讓網頁變得更加生動有趣,同時也可以提高用戶的交互體驗。希望這篇文章對您有所幫助。
上一篇css 圖片垂直居右
下一篇css 圖片下面有白邊